After trying a mineral foundation last week but it unfortunately not matching my skin tone I decided to try and different brand and colour because I loved the feel of the product on my skin and liked the coverage it gave. I ordered Lily Lolo's Mineral Foundation in Porcelain from Cutecosmetics, after Rachel from Cutecosmetics recommended it to me as a better match for my skin. It arrived today (yay) and I'm a very happy bunny.



I like the packaging of this, it's simple and the sifter is great to avoid having loads of excess product on your brush, however you can remove it if you don't like it. It's also a good size you get 10g of product in a 40ml tub so its not too huge to be carrying around. The product itself has no harsh chemical or parabens and has a natural spf, which is great if you have pale skin like me. It's also suitable for vegetarians and vegans! So thats a great start, but the best part is it matches my skin perfectly!! I'm so happy because it is a very fine line for me and foundation of any kind but this is probably the best i've ever found. It's a good coverage and doesn't look powdery on my skin, which is good because I prefer a natural looking foundation for everyday. It retails for £12.49 which is great value I think, considering the price of other mineral foundations on the market. So i'd definitely recommend this product to anyone who like me struggles to find foundations light enough!

The second thing is the EOS Lip Balm sphere in Strawberry Sorbet, I ordered this last week again from Cutecosmetics (which is definitely becoming one of my favourite sites!) and i've been using it everyday since!


I love the packaging, its just so different from anything else! It's tactile and makes applying the balm so easy. Love the colours of the cases as well, each flavour has a different colour which is cute. It smells amazing, pretty much like a sweet shop, which I love because I definitely have a sweet tooth! It has shea butter, jojoba oil and vitamin E and these combined leave your lips feeling so smooth and it lasts for ages unlike other lip balms that seem to disappear after a few minutes. My lips feel really hydrated after using this. This product has been raved about on many blogs and sites so I was a bit dubious that it wouldn't live up to the hype but it definitely does and i'm glad I got it. It retails for £5.95, which is more than i'd normally spend on a lip balm but it was worth it, for the cute packaging and mainly because the product itself is great.
